Search a number
-
+
31132201211122 = 2119371787845129
BaseRepresentation
bin1110001010000100001111…
…10010110101010011110010
311002020012122122000112120211
413011002013302311103302
513040032222002223442
6150113534044254334
76362140653034564
oct705020762652362
9132205578015524
1031132201211122
119a13101a72620
1235a97672413aa
13144a9a56462ab
14798b41373334
1538ec4775e617
hex1c5087cb54f2

31132201211122 has 32 divisors (see below), whose sum is σ = 51026569513920. Its totient is φ = 14127970970880.

The previous prime is 31132201211071. The next prime is 31132201211179. The reversal of 31132201211122 is 22111210223113.

It is a happy number.

It is a super-2 number, since 2×311322012111222 (a number of 28 digits) contains 22 as substring.

It is a Harshad number since it is a multiple of its sum of digits (22).

It is a junction number, because it is equal to n+sod(n) for n = 31132201211093 and 31132201211102.

It is an unprimeable number.

It is a polite number, since it can be written in 15 ways as a sum of consecutive naturals, for example, 36414654 + ... + 37259782.

It is an arithmetic number, because the mean of its divisors is an integer number (1594580297310).

Almost surely, 231132201211122 is an apocalyptic number.

31132201211122 is a deficient number, since it is larger than the sum of its proper divisors (19894368302798).

31132201211122 is a wasteful number, since it uses less digits than its factorization.

31132201211122 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 847866.

The product of its (nonzero) digits is 288, while the sum is 22.

Adding to 31132201211122 its reverse (22111210223113), we get a palindrome (53243411434235).

The spelling of 31132201211122 in words is "thirty-one trillion, one hundred thirty-two billion, two hundred one million, two hundred eleven thousand, one hundred twenty-two".

Divisors: 1 2 11 22 937 1787 1874 3574 10307 19657 20614 39314 845129 1674419 1690258 3348838 9296419 18418609 18592838 36837218 791885873 1510245523 1583771746 3020491046 8710744603 16612700753 17421489206 33225401506 1415100055051 2830200110102 15566100605561 31132201211122